Colin Bullen FIA Behavior Change Actuary

Colin is an actuary by profession having originally qualified in the UK before spending 13 years in South Africa before joining Chicago-based Habits at Work. His passion for behavior change derives from watching with bewilderment as healthcare inflation radically undermined the affordability of healthcare services in across the globe.  Colin believes that all worthwhile change can be justified by a business case and has developed frameworks with the Behavioral Research and Applied Technology Laboratory to prove it. 

A genuine believer in following the path less traveled, Colin enjoys challenging convention and has enjoyed transitioning into what may be the world’s only behavior change actuary. With partner, Hanlie van Wyk, Colin has created one of the most in-depth studies of available research into how and when humans change behavior and the extent to which there are beneficial outcomes when they do.
